Runbook: Recovering the Keywhirl rotation account

If Keywhirl locks itself out mid-rotation (happens more than we'd like), don't panic. Pause the rotation queue, confirm no half-rotated secrets in the Darnell staging set, then re-authenticate the service account through the recovery console. When prompted, enter the recovery passphrase, which is appended right below this line.

strongbox words: druwyn-lamvan-julath-sorox-ralius-wenael-briiel-aldiel-ulaius-belath-casath-ulamir-ulair-norir

Finance Review Summary – Halverton Appliances

Branch managers: warranty costs on the Brightcore kettle range ran 22% over forecast this quarter, driven by heating-element returns from the Nordale batch. A supplier remedy is being negotiated and accruals have been adjusted accordingly. Please log all related claims under the dedicated warranty code until further notice. The confidential planning note is set out immediately below.

management briefing: Only 5 of the 80 pilot accounts renewed Zorix, so a churn review is set for October 1.

Ticket PIXVAULT-2214: Config drift on the thumbnail cache nodes. Two of the four Pixvault image-cache hosts are running last quarter's eviction settings, which is why the memory leak resurfaced only on those boxes. The cache never releases decoded frames once the drifted TTL kicks in. New folks: always compare against the canonical values before debugging. The expected configuration for all cache nodes is as follows.

deployment values, yadug-bawif:
[framir]
team = pelox
access_code = ac_a38ab2
owner = tamion.julael
host = framir.tolvaqlabs.test
port = 11211
peer = tammir.zemvargrid.local
salt = 2215ef03
pin = 1541